The journalist reminded the hierarchs of the OCU of their earlier statements about Filaret

Journalist Yuri Doroshenko, who actively supports the restoration of the Kyiv Patriarchate, reminded the hierarchs of the OCU how they spoke about Filaret in the old days. An article on the occasion of the 55th anniversary of the appointment of the then hierarch of the ROC to the Kyiv cathedra was published on the official website of the UOC-KP.

“The Kyiv Patriarchate conciliarly elected lord Filaret as its primate for life. There are no canonical or statutory grounds for his removal from office. On the contrary, you can only be grateful to him for the fact that in a more than respectable age and in external unfavorable conditions, through his work, as a primate, the Kyiv Patriarchate is growing, gaining strength, gaining authority in society,” these are beautiful words. The only pity is that one of the biggest traitors and liars – the notorious archbishop Yevstratiy Zorya, wrote them. Now he speaks and writes in a completely different way… The place of sitting and the lack of principles and morality of this church leader make him already sing hosanna to others.

Epiphany, Yevstratiy and their political puppeteers are satisfied with the OCU in the status of a metropolis. They are satisfied with the dependence on the Greek Patriarch from Istanbul. They rejoice that they traded independence for recognition of dependence (although it should be said that even this metropolis enslaved by the Phanar was not recognized by most of the local Orthodox churches, and their primates shy away from Epiphany as if they were a leper). The ancient low self-esteem desire to have a good and distant master, perhaps, is in the blood of the OCU adherents,” writes Yuri Doroshenko.
